SPOKANE, WA (November 26, 2012) - The Shock have been assigned defensive end William Green to the 2013 roster.
Green, a product of the University of Florida, joins the Shock for his rookie season in the AFL as a versatile pass rushing defensive end. In his four collegiate seasons as a Gator, Green saw action in 53 total games (started four) on his way to recording 53 total tackles (31 solo), 11 tackles-for-loss, and 2.5 sacks.
"Green is an explosive defensive end that as the quickness and hustle we want our defensive line to have," said Shock Head General Manager Ryan Rigmaiden.
